在我们构建高性能的后端服务时,I/O 操作的处理方式往往是决定系统吞吐量的关键因素。你是否想过,为什么 Node.js 作为一个单线程运行时,却能够轻松处理成千上万的并发请求?这背后其实离不开一个强大的设计模式——Rea…
coding
Windows 11 重启完全指南:从基础操作到 2026 年智能运维实践
作为微软推出的全新一代操作系统,Windows 11 不仅拥有焕然一新的视觉设计,更在底层交互逻辑上进行了深度优化。对于无论是刚刚接触 PC 的新用户,还是经验丰富的系统管理员,掌握“重启”这一看似简单的操作都至关重要。…
12 和 18 的最大公因数 (HCF)
在我们的日常开发与算法设计中,数学不仅仅是数字的游戏,更是构建逻辑大厦的基石。你可能已经注意到,即便是最基础的数学概念,如最大公因数 (HCF),在现代计算机科学中依然扮演着至关重要的角色。在本文中,我们将深入探讨 12…
2026年深度解析:numpy.ones() 的底层原理、性能调优与现代 AI 工程实践
在 2026 年的今天,Python 依然是数据科学领域的通用语言,但开发者的关注点早已从单纯的“功能实现”转向了“极致能效”与“人机协作”。当我们谈论 numpy.ones() 时,我们不仅仅是在讨论一个生成全 1 数…
深入理解无理数:从数学抽象到 2026 年的高精度计算实践
在编程和数学的广阔领域中,数据的精度和类型至关重要。作为一名开发者,你可能在处理浮点数运算时遇到过令人头疼的精度丢失问题,或者在设计图形算法时需要极高的数学精确度。这背后的核心概念往往与一种特殊的数字类型——无理数有关。…
2026 前沿视角:Firebase Realtime Database 在 AI 原生时代的核心应用与深度优化
在 2026 年这个“即时满足”与“AI 原生”并行的数字时代,用户对应用程序的响应速度和智能程度的期待达到了前所未有的高度。无论是多人在线游戏中的实时排行榜、基于 Agentic AI 的自主代理协作,还是社交软件中的…
如何在 R 语言中实现图形叠加?从基础绘图到多图层可视化
在数据分析和可视化的过程中,你是否遇到过这样的场景:手中有一组自变量 $x$,却对应着多组不同的因变量 $y$,或者你希望在同一张图表上直观地对比不同模型拟合的结果与原始数据?如果为每一组数据单独绘制一张图表,往往很难在…
Java 基本类型数组切片完全指南:从底层原理到实战应用
在日常的 Java 开发中,我们经常需要处理数组。虽然 Java 的集合框架非常强大,但基本类型数组(如 INLINECODEb9888bb8, INLINECODEe82e1648 等)因为其内存占用小、无装箱开销、在…
深入理解 Java 中 i++ 和 ++i 的本质区别与应用
在 Java 的学习与面试过程中,INLINECODE64cf48fe(后置递增)和 INLINECODE48143500(前置递增)的区别是一个经典且极其重要的话题。很多初学者在面对 a = i++ 这样的表达式时,往…
Python 实战技巧:如何根据索引列表高效计算列表元素的乘积
在处理数据密集型任务或编写日常脚本时,我们经常需要从列表中提取特定位置的元素并执行聚合操作。最常见的聚合操作之一就是计算乘积。虽然通过索引访问单个元素非常简单,但当我们面对一个包含多个目标位置的“索引列表”,并希望计算这…
